Article
The sup-pf-2 mutations of Chlamydomonas alter the activity of the outer dynein arms by modification of the gamma-dynein heavy chain.
The Journal of cell biology - 1 Dec 1996
Rupp G, O'Toole E, Gardner L C, Mitchell B F, Porter M E
Abstract excerpt
The sup-pf-2 mutation is a member of a group of dynein regulatory mutations that are capable of restoring motility to paralyzed central pair or radial spoke defective strains. Previous work has shown that the flagellar beat frequency is reduced in sup-pf-2, but little else was known about the sup...
